要求:打印 2 - 100000 當中的素數與非素數。(素數定義:在大於1的自然數中,除了1和它本身以外不再有其他因數) 1. 常規方式——對正整數n,如果用2到 之間的所有整數去除,均無法整除,則n為質數: 注意這里用一個布爾類型的數組用於素數的判斷與最終結果的打印 ...
輸出質數 素數 素數 質數 :是指在大於 的自然數中,除了 和它本身外,不能被其他自然數整除 除 以外 的數 ...
2021-07-30 02:10 0 164 推薦指數:
要求:打印 2 - 100000 當中的素數與非素數。(素數定義:在大於1的自然數中,除了1和它本身以外不再有其他因數) 1. 常規方式——對正整數n,如果用2到 之間的所有整數去除,均無法整除,則n為質數: 注意這里用一個布爾類型的數組用於素數的判斷與最終結果的打印 ...
package com.day3.one; public class PrimeNumber { /** * @param args * 打印101-200之間的素數 */ public static void main(String[] args ...
Java實現求質數(素數) 題目要求: 代碼實現: 運行結果: System.currentTimeMillis() 該方法的作用是返回當前的計算機時間,時間的表達格式為當前計算機時間和GMT時間(格林威治時間)1970年1月1號0時0分0秒所差的毫秒數。返回的是 long ...
@ 目錄 朴素算法 code 優化 code 埃氏篩法 code 朴素算法 首先,我們得知道素數的概念:除了1和這個數本身,這個數沒有其他因子(約數),這個數就是一個素數。不是素數的數 ...
這篇筆記講講關於java中質數的問題。 一、什么是質數(素數)? 定義:質數又稱素數。一個大於1的自然數,除了1和它自身外,不能被其他自然數整除的數叫做質數;否則稱為合數。它可以有無限個數。 二、java習題:輸出1-100之內的所有質數 這題有幾種解題思路: 第一種思路 ...
1、外層循環作為被除數,內層循環作為除數。 2、定義一個Boolean,標記外層循環數是否為質數。默認為 true。 3、內層循環結束,如果開關還為true。即被除數為質數,打印出來。 代碼如下: 運行效果: 第二種思路 ...
素數(質數):一個大於1的自然數,除了1和它自身以外,不能整除其它的自然數。 合數:一個大於1的自然數,除了1和它自身以外,還能整除其它的自然數。 其實大於1的自然數中,如果不是素數(質數),那么它就是合數 擴展: 所有大於2的偶數都是合數 所有大於5的奇數中 ...
素數的定義:是指在大於1的自然數中,除了1和它本身以外不再有其他因數的自然數。即只能被1和自己本身整除的數。 判定一個數是否為素數的基本思路:1、了解素數的定義,一個正整數n若為素數,則它的約數只能是1和n本身,2、根據定義,我們需要將這個數除以從2到n-1之間的全部正整數,如果全部都不能整除 ...